Henry Percy, Earl of Northumberland

A rebel, Northumberland is a member of the Percy family and the father of Hotspur. He played a significant role helping King Henry to the crown in Richard II and in Henry IV Part 1 is disgruntled with the new king. Northumberland takes part in plotting the rebellion against Henry, but when push comes to shove, he phones in sick and leaves his son hanging. His failure to show at the battle at Shrewsbury reminds us that fathers can't always be trusted to protect their children.
